Udesa Fora Station is located in the Sukke Chiga Kebele of Kercha, in Ethiopia’s Guji zone, and it is managed by Mekonnen Beriso. The name “Udesa Fora” translates to “restingRoast date / restingSpecialty bags carry the roast date, not a best-before. Coffee needs days to degas CO₂ after roasting ('resting') and is typically best within weeks, not months. under a tree,” inspired by the shade-grown coffee of this region. Between 300–400 farmers contribute their cherries to the station, primarily growing the heirloomHeirloom (Ethiopia)A catch-all label for Ethiopia's thousands of indigenous, largely uncatalogued coffee varieties — used when a lot's exact genetics are unknown. 74112 and 74158 varieties at elevations ranging from 1,900 to 2,100 m.a.s.l. This washedWashed processThe fruit is removed from the seed before drying, usually with fermentation and a water rinse. Tends to give clean, transparent cups where origin character shows clearly. lot begins with meticulous cherry selection once they are brought to the station. The cherries are then depulped and left to ferment for 72 hours before being washed and spread on drying beds for 8-12 days, depending on the weather. Udesa Fora’s high elevation mixed with its shade trees offers a unique microclimate. This means cool nights and moderate sun rays that allow cherries to develop complex sugars. Established in 1996 as producers, Daye Bensa has lived through all the turmoils that coffee growing and exporting entail in the region. Nowadays, they are a reference of excellence and resilience in Ethiopia and work with various communities of out-growers from whom they receive cherries. They work with multiple washing stations in the Bensa, Sidama area, including some that they own. Recommendation: Resting time: 3 weeks Espresso: 1:2.2-2.5, 94c Filter: 1:16-17, 94c
